Dena — calibration weights from the Morvex audit are crated on bay 3, twelve units, all sealed. Tare cards are taped to each lid. Do not restack; the 20 kg blocks crack the pallets. Courier from Quickhart arrives Thursday before noon. Sign the transfer sheet yourself, no delegating. Confidential hand-over instruction follows below.

handover note for yagef-bagep: the drudor pelius courier leaves the kasdor zorvan norir ledger at gate 8016 under passcode 755406

Internal Memo — Budget Request

To the sales leads: Operations has submitted a budget request to fund two additional demo kits for the Vellane product line and travel support for the Ashgrove territory push. Finance expects a decision within two weeks. No changes to current spending limits until then; log any urgent needs with your regional coordinator. Background on the request's purpose appears below.

board note of fahaf-fadug: Gilixax Logistics is in early talks to buy Praiusax Partners for about $8.1 million. The Pramir launch date is September 23, and nothing goes to the press before then.

# This constant caps how many source files the extractor
# scans per run. If the nightly job stalls, it is almost
# always because someone dropped a huge generated file
# into the strings directory; the cap keeps the run bounded
# so the queue drains. Raising it is safe but slows the
# Pireno pipeline. If you change the value, rerun the
# extractor manually and confirm catalog counts match the
# dashboard. The verification run emits the token you should
# paste on the line below this comment.

pipeline stamp: htk31_f769b577b3028a4e9958e5bb8d1259a

## Authentication

The Quillgate circuit breaker wraps all calls to the upstream Marrowfield pricing API. When the breaker is open, requests short-circuit and return cached quotes; when half-open, a single probe request is sent. Reviewers should note that probe requests must carry valid credentials even in the open state, since Marrowfield rejects anonymous health checks. The probe client authenticates using the bearer token provided below.

session JWT of yawep-yawep = eyJhbGciOiJIUzI1NiIsInR5cCI6IkpXVCJ9.eyJzdWIiOiI3pWF3_In0.aXYsHiog